问题:WP查询帖子计数始终为0
答案:在WordPress中,查询帖子计数为0可能是由于以下几个原因导致的:
- 数据库问题:首先,确保数据库连接正常,并且数据库中的帖子数据没有被意外删除或损坏。可以通过检查数据库中的wp_posts表来确认帖子是否存在。
- 缓存问题:如果你使用了缓存插件,尝试清除缓存并重新加载页面,以确保计数是最新的。
- 查询条件错误:查询帖子计数为0可能是因为查询条件不正确。请确保你使用正确的查询参数和条件来获取帖子。可以参考WordPress官方文档中的WP_Query类来了解如何正确构建查询。
- 插件或主题问题:某些插件或主题可能会干扰帖子计数的正常显示。尝试禁用最近安装的插件或更换主题,然后重新加载页面,看看计数是否恢复正常。
- 数据库索引问题:如果你的网站有大量帖子,可能是由于数据库索引问题导致查询计数变慢。可以考虑优化数据库索引或使用缓存插件来提高查询性能。
总结:查询帖子计数始终为0可能是由于数据库问题、缓存问题、查询条件错误、插件或主题问题、数据库索引问题等原因导致的。通过检查数据库连接、清除缓存、检查查询条件、禁用插件或更换主题、优化数据库索引等方法,可以解决这个问题。
腾讯云相关产品推荐:腾讯云数据库(https://cloud.tencent.com/product/cdb)提供高性能、可扩展的数据库解决方案,可用于存储和管理WordPress网站的数据。